I believe those temps are about right for a B3 processor. 60C load is about right, and 40C seems about right as well. I bieleve the fan should be blowing into the CPU HS... Or at least thats what my stock HSF did on my other pc. Sometimes it seems the air is coming out of a high speed fan when you put your hand over it, but it is actully sucking in air. That's the case with my PSU's fan. Try holding a small piece of paper (hold it so it doesnt slip out of your hand) in front of the CPU HSF. If the paper stays streight, then the fan is sucking air in. If it flaps back towards you, then the air is blowing out. You may want to purchase a third party HSF.

Coretemp gives far higher temperatures than most programs because it actually reads the internal temperature, rather than the approximate external temperature. On that basis, the temps you've got are fine. Anything below 70 in coretemp and below 50 in speedfan is fine.

As for the temps, different programs might have different or wrong interpretations of the data sent, although usually when this is the case they're obviously wrong (-255 or something stupid) With regard to the CPU fan, it depends what sort of heatsink it is. The usual method with normal heatsinks (where the fan is the same way up as the motherboard) the fan sucks air down through the fins of the heatsink towards the motherboard. If it's a heatsink that exhausts air sideways ('along' the motherboard) then you want it blowing towards the exit fan in the case, so usually the rear.

The best test you can do is to run a stress-intensive test like Orthos and leave it running for 10 mins or so. Then look at the values CoreTemp gives. As long as they're more than a few degrees below the TJunction figure, you're fine.
